rosemary meaning name

Rosemary is a feminine given name, a combination of the names Rose and Mary. Often given in honor of the Virgin Mary, whose flower is the rose. It may also be spelled Rosmarie in German-speaking countries. Rosalee Name Meaning. Origin of the name Rosemary: Combination name formed from the names Rose (horse; rose) and Mary. Combination of the names Rose and Marie. [1] Rosemary has been in steady use in the United States and has ranked among the top 1,000 for 110 years. Its greatest period of popularity in the United States was between 1925 and 1950, when it was ranked among the top 150 names for girls. [2] Rosemarie is another variant, and Romy is a German nickname for the name. The name Rosemary is a girl's name of Latin origin meaning "dew of the sea, or rosemary (herb)". The name “Rosemary” is a 19th-century coinage, from the name of the herb (which is from Latin “ros marīnus”, meaning “sea dew”). In French Baby Names the meaning of the name Rosemarie is: Bitter. Despite appearances, Rosemary is not a “smoosh” name, not even a traditional one. rosemary (n.) late 14c., earlier rosmarine (c. 1300), from Latin rosmarinus, literally "dew of the sea" (compare French romarin), from ros "dew" + marinus "of the sea, maritime," from mare "sea, the sea, seawater," from PIE root *mori-"body of water."
